Not as good as people think. Mage secrets are generally not very good and with Mad Scientist being a wild card, you can't justify running them in any Mage deck that isn't freeze.
You have to play 2 secrets for it to have very good value, a 4 mana 5/5 isn't insane as everybody seems to think. 1 attack off Chillwind Yeti stats.
Even if you get the reduction to 2 mana, at that point a 5/5 for 2 after sacrificing tempo and board presence is just bad. You would've have had to play 2 secrets turn 3 and 4 or 2 secrets turn 2 and 3 with the coin. Playing secrets back to back in itself is slow.
The dream set up for this card is to play 2 Kabal Lackeys turn 1 with 2 secrets and then to top deck Kabal Crystal Runner. This would have 2 2/1 and 1 5/5 with 2 secrets in play. But even with this play, you've just depleted your whole hand as a Mage.
The reason Thing from Below was played because you would still play your standard Shaman cards without having to play abnormally. The Thing from Below would be just a huge plus for playing normally. With Kabal Crystal Runner, you have to play in a way which is sub optimal for what is even a worse card because Thing from Below has taunt.

It's very good if you get the effect off, similar to what Ancient of Lore was before it's nerf. It's cost is fine for what the effect is.
Only problem is that it's conditional and you can't drop it on an empty board.

It also summons a non-golden copy if you have a non-golden Barnes regardless if the copied card is golden or not.
